Appli­ca­tion

Low vis­cos­i­ty silanol flu­ids are employed as filler treat­ments and­struc­ture con­trol addi­tives in sil­i­cone rub­ber compounding.Intermediate vis­cos­i­ty, 1000-10,000 cSt. flu­ids can be applied totex­tiles as durable fab­ric soft­en­ers. High vis­cos­i­ty silanolter­mi­nat­ed flu­ids form the matrix­com­po­nent in tack­i­fiers and pres­sure sen­si­tive adhe­sives.
It is a low mol­e­c­u­lar weight poly­di­methyl­silox­ane ter­mi­nat­ed with a sil­i­con hydrox­yl group and is a low vis­cos­i­ty hydroxy sil­i­cone oil.
